STANDING ORDER NO. 08/1994 (EXPORTS) 

SUB:  PROCEDURE FOR FILING OF SUPPLEMENTARY CLAIMS.

A number of supplementary claims are regularly filed on the plea that:-

a)        The deduction has been made as a result of examination report, Laboratory report, variation in weight, blend ratio, short shipment, variation in quantity and description etc.;

b)        The deduction has been made by applying the value ascertained by the Valuation Committee;

c)        The deduction has been made due to short realization of sales proceeds.

2.         In order to streamline the procedure regarding receipt of supplementary claims are in para-I above the following procedure is laid down:-

(i)            The exporters will file supplementary claims alongwith application giving reasons for filing of claim.

(ii)          Prior to registration, the supplementary claims as in para 1 above will be scrutinized then Principal Appraiser, Incharge of Rebate group will affix stamp “Supplementary claim admissible”. The claim will then be forwarded to the counter for registration. In case the claim is found inadmissible, Principal Appraiser Incharge will intimate the exporter in writing, stating will intimate the exporter in writing, stating the reasons of the inadmissibility, be registered Post.

(iii)         Supplementary claims filed on account of revision of duty drawback notification will however continue to be registered directly at the counter. The counter clerk will check will check the copy of the revised notification and register the claim.

This order shall become effective from 1st November, 1994.
